Compliments


A dear friend of mine once told me, “It’s best to take a compliment as if you are dead”.  I believed him.  But it has taken years to be able to understand the mechanics of why that’s right. 

I have learned that compliments float by if you pay them no mind.  But if you hold them and examine their intent, you will be injured. 

You see, they have tiny anchors on tiny chains.  While you are holding them the captain lowers all anchors.  As you examine, your pride becomes exposed.  And the tiny anchors latch to the very roots of pride. 

They’re a real pain to unstick since pride hides in our blind spot.  Usually one must swallow a few “horse pill” size doses of humiliation.   This will reduce the size of your pride and the tiny anchors will loose their grip.

Since flattery abounds, and the threat often comes from nowhere, it’s best to keep taking humiliation as a daily dosage.
